# Quartzmesh API — env for the N+1 fix rollout
# Context for on-call: the GraphQL resolver batching (dataloader
# layer) is toggled here. DATALOADER_ENABLED must stay true or the
# authors->posts resolver regresses to one query per row and the
# replica saturates within minutes. Batch size is tuned; do not
# change it without a load test. The cache service credential is
# required and is set on the following line.

vault entry, hagug-fahag: COURIER_KEY3=30e

This quarter's review recommends reducing the marketing budget by 15%, approximately matching the underspend observed in the Kelverton campaign. Paid media for the Lunaris product line will be paused; brand work continues at reduced scale. The savings improve the operating margin forecast by 1.2 points and extend runway by one quarter. No redundancies are proposed; two contractor engagements end naturally. The board should weigh this against the strategic consideration set out in the note below.

internal memo for yajeg-fahof: Casaxek Freight plans to raise the Belael list price by 53.4 percent in June. The finance team signed off on a budget of $298.3 million for Project Pelax. The renewal with Fravanox Logistics closes at $209.5 million a year, 29.2 percent below the last contract. Project Praax slips by two quarters because of the staffing delay.

**Mgmt Meeting Minutes — Retiring the Brightline Range**

Quick recap for sales leads at Fenholt Supplies: we agreed to retire the Brightline fixture range by year-end. Remaining stock moves to clearance pricing next month, and accounts on standing orders get migrated to the Lumetta range. Trade-in incentives were approved in principle. The confidential note on next steps sits just below.

board note of bajof-bajeg: The pricing group signed off on a budget of $13.4 million for Project Sildor. The renewal with Lamixek Holdings closes at $48.9 million a year, 49 percent above the last contract.